Stunning start in Singapore - Su the local guide was brilliant. She was very informative and engaging. She had spare travel cards we could use if we weren't able to use bankcards on public transport. Wasn't expecting to love Singapore as much as I did. Enough free time to go on a boat trip and visit the amazing Gardens By the Bay and use Su's travel card. Hotel was good too location and I arrived very early and they were able to get me checked me early. Malaysia was good too but more full on. Melaka was fun, Kuala Lumpur again I enjoyed much more than I was expecting. Location of the hotel was great. Ipoh interesting. The Homestay was very good - not tempted to swim in the lake and the only time we had rain but very atmospheric. Cameron Highlands and Mossy Forest and Tea Plantation very interesting. The two local guides/drivers were again excellent. Penang and the temple visit were highlights. After the trip I had another couple of nights in Penang and discovered the free bus that runs round Georgetown every 15 minutes - this would have been good to know about as I did a lot of walking in Penang. Hotel a bit far out. Langkawi was a good end to the trip. Very relaxing and again lots of walking as a resort hotel on the beach which was comfortable though on the outskirts of the town. Bizarrely there was a lovely infinity pool BUT even as guests you had to pay to use it! Lovely fun group of 9 and so many guides, all good. Andrew the tour leader, Sam, our Malaysian guide and Hasli who normally guides in Borneo. Could be my next trip!
